Transaction 21292b577daf56db79df841ae04a925c41951141ed4fdf39bdd5a2a871fc3bed

1 Input
2 Outputs
  • 21292b577daf56db79df841ae04a925c41951141ed4fdf39bdd5a2a871fc3bed:0
  • value  109556
    address  35rhZU3rjkJfVbyDPsx7b8zpfBJfefW6Rn
  • 21292b577daf56db79df841ae04a925c41951141ed4fdf39bdd5a2a871fc3bed:1
  • value  2666794
    address  1ChoRmkU6DPT5qmferjpz2UnE2srCgTUjm